This assembly was Rachel's Challenge where the speakers challenged us to make a difference in other's lives.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;On April 20, 1999, the worst high school shooting &lt;span id="SPELLING_ERROR_0" class="blsp-spelling-corrected"&gt;occurred&lt;/span&gt; in &lt;span id="SPELLING_ERROR_1" class="blsp-spelling-error"&gt;Littleton&lt;/span&gt;, Colorado at Columbine High School.  2 students walked into the school with guns and fired at the students and teachers.  12 students and one teacher were killed and the gunmen shot themselves.  The first to be killed of the students was Rachel Joy Scott.  Rachel had this theory that if someone went out of their way to show kindness, it would start a chain reaction.  A few weeks before the shooting, Rachel wrote an essay about her ethics and her codes of life.  In the essay she said, "If one person can go out of their way to show compassion, then it will start a chain reaction of the same.  People will never know how far a little kindness will go."  Rachel lived her life by that standard.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;A few weeks her death, her family found something that she had written when she was 13.  On the back of her dresser, she drew the outlines of her hands and in the middle she wrote, "These hands belong to Rachel Joey Scott and will someday touch millions of people's hearts."  Rachel had a &lt;span id="SPELLING_ERROR_2" class="blsp-spelling-corrected"&gt;premonition&lt;/span&gt; that she was going to die young.  She wrote about it in her journal and also about her codes of life.  On the back of her journal, she wrote,"I will not be labeled as average."  Rachel wanted to make sure that she would start a chain reaction of compassion and kindness and that is exactly what she did.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;At the end of Rachel's Challenge, they challenged us to 5 things;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;ol&gt;&lt;li&gt;Look for the best in others- eliminate prejudice&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Dare to dream- set goals and keep a journal&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;choose positive influences- input determines output&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Little acts of kindness-  use kind words&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;Start a chain reaction!&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ol&gt;&lt;p&gt;Rachel reached out to 3 groups of kids; the new students, the &lt;span id="SPELLING_ERROR_3" class="blsp-spelling-corrected"&gt;disabled&lt;/span&gt; students, and the ones that have been put down or pushed down.  During Rachel's Challenge, they talked about a new student who had just moved to Colorado from Georgia.  She was sitting alone at a lunch table and Rachel was the only one who seemed to notice.  Rachel went over to the table and introduced herself, and even though the girl said she didn't want to sit with Rachel and her friends, Rachel still brought her friends over to her table.  Later Rachel would find out that a month earlier, the girl's mom had just died in a car accident and that is why her dad moved her and her brother to Colorado.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;They also told a story of a boy who was &lt;span id="SPELLING_ERROR_4" class="blsp-spelling-corrected"&gt;disabled&lt;/span&gt; and picked on all the time.  The day Rachel became his friend, two other boys were picking on him and pushing him against the lockers.  Rachel &lt;span id="SPELLING_ERROR_5" class="blsp-spelling-corrected"&gt;intervened&lt;/span&gt; and told the boys to back off or they could fight her.  The boys backed off and Rachel became friends with the boy.  It wasn't until after Rachel's death that the boy told Rachel's family that the day she &lt;span id="SPELLING_ERROR_6" class="blsp-spelling-corrected"&gt;intervened&lt;/span&gt;, was the day the boy had planned to take his own life. I CAN"T WAIT FOR HOCKEY SEASON TO START!!!! &lt;span class="blsp-spelling-error" id="SPELLING_ERROR_8"&gt;woohoo&lt;/span&gt;!!!&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/781128916813791931-4980704537645275305?l=avsfreak.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://avsfreak.blogspot.com/feeds/4980704537645275305/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://avsfreak.blogspot.com/2009/07/life-with-dad-3.html#comment-form'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/781128916813791931/posts/default/4980704537645275305'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/781128916813791931/posts/default/4980704537645275305'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://avsfreak.blogspot.com/2009/07/life-with-dad-3.html' title='Life with dad 3...'/><author><name>Avs Freak</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/09622350879516415124</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='31' height='21' src='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_1hBsFYf926w/SeoS9nuKoLI/AAAAAAAAABI/4UN9tKmcEoY/S220/070102113827_avs.jpg'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-781128916813791931.post-7322000614909282582</id><published>2009-07-09T14:35:00.008-06:00</published><updated>2009-07-09T16:11:51.397-06:00</updated><title type='text'>A tribute to Joe...</title><content type='html'>Since the 1992-93 season, Joe Sakic has been the Captain of the Avs/Nordiques franchise. He spent his whole career with this one franchise. He has been the heart and soul of the Avs ever since they became a team in 1995 and he has been a hero to many. Joe did so many things to help this franchise through the years. He helped bring hockey back to Colorado, and bring Colorado it's first professional championship. He helped someone to win his first cup after he had played 22 seasons in the NHL. Joe has been the only captain in Avs history and when the 09-10 season starts, there will be a new captain. Today, Joe announced his retirement from hockey.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Here are some of the major highlights of Joe's NHL career: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;June 13, 1987 - Joe was drafted 15th overall by the Quebec Nordiques.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;October 6, 1988 - Joe made his NHL debut and recorded his first career point.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;October 8, 1988 -Joe scored his first career goal in a 5-3 loss against the New Jersey Devils.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;October 5, 1989 - Joe played his first game wearing number 19 (the number he wore for the rest of his career). &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;March 31, 1990 - Joe recorded his first 100 point season.  &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;1992-93 season - Joe became the captain of the Nordiques.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;April 25, 1996 - Joe scored his first career playoff hat trick against the New York Rangers.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;June 10, 1996 - Joe wins his first Stanley Cup and Conn Smythe Trophy.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;li&gt;March 14, 1997 - Joe scored his first regular season hat trick for the Avs.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;August 6, 1997 - Joe signed a three-year, $21 million offer sheet with the New York Rangers but the offer was matched by Colorado to keep Joe on the Avs.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;December 27, 1999 - Joe became the 56th player in NHL history to record 1,000 career points.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;June 9, 2001 - Joe wins his second Stanley Cup along with the Hart Trophy (awarded to most valuable player), the Lady Byng Trophy (the player who shows the most sportsmanship), the Lester B. Pearson Award (the NHL's most outstanding player during the regular season, and named to the all-star game.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;February 24, 2002 - Joe helps Team Canada to the gold medal and named tournament MVP.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;December 11, 2002 - Joe becomes the 31st player in NHL history to record 500 career goals.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;April 24, 2006 - Joe scored his 7th career overtime goal (NHL playoff record). &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;October 25, 2006 - Joe becomes the 11th player in NHL history to record 1,500 career points.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;February 15, 2007 - Joe became the 17th player to record 600 career goals. &l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;October 23, 2008 - Joe scores his 625th goal, his final goal of his career.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;November 2, 2008 - Joe records his 1,641st career point, his final point of his career.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;November 28, 2008 - Joe appears in his final game before sitting out the rest of the season with a back injury. He played one shift of the game.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;li&gt;July 9, 2009 - Joe announces his retirement from hockey.&lt;/li&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;As I said before, Joe has been a hero to many and has helped so many people. Here are some other things he has done: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In 2001, when the Avs won their second cup, Joe didn't take the victory lap around the rink with the Cup first like captains always do. Instead, Joe gave the Cup straight to Ray Bourque who had played 22 season in the NHL (20 and half seasons with the Bruins) and still looking for his first Stanley Cup victory. Joe gave the Cup to Ray who was crying with excitement and he took the first lap while Joe waited his turn.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Joe's first few seasons with the Nordiques, he was mentored by the great Peter Stastny. In 2006, Peter's son, Paul, was drafted by the Avs and Joe mentored him. Joe was one of Paul Stastny's heroes growing up and Joe helped him throughout the 3 years they got to play together.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Joe spent the last 2 seasons of his career with injuries that made him miss most of the season. 2 years ago, Joe had surgery for a sports hernia. Last season, he played a total of 15 games because of a herniated disc in his back and 3 broken fingers because of a snow blower incident. Joe was one of the many players on the Avs that were hurt last season.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The 2 main reasons why Joe is retiring;&lt;br /&gt;1) He is still recovering from the injuries last season and he didn't want to risk getting hurt again.&lt;br /&gt;2) Joe has 3 kids; Mitch, Chase, and Kamryn. Mitch is 12 and plays hockey. Chase and Kamryn are twins, 9 years old. Chase plays soccer and Kamryn does gymnastics. Joe wanted to be able to go to their sports games and be able to spend more time with them.
